Recently, one of the most liked trends among women has been the growth in lower back tattoos. This describes the practice of having a design tattooed on the center lower area of the back just above or below the waist line.

The recognition of this lower back tattoos placement has been powered by the present fashion for low cut jeans and short tops, which give the ideal setting to display these designs. So if you are considering getting a lower back tattoos, these are some of the main advantages and downsides to bear in mind.
The benefits of most lower back tattoos occasionally is the position meaning that they are either permanently on show or concealed by clothing. But due to modern clothing trends including low cut jeans and crop tops, the back is the perfect place for a tattoo if you wish to reach a'now you see it, now you don't' effect. This fragile approach to tattoo placement is like the growing trend among men for tattoos on the bottom of the forearm. Unlike a front forearm tattoo which is highly plain, an insider design will be hidden for lots of the time. But when you saw the design, it is going to be more clear. Another excuse for the recognition of lower back tattoos is the sensuality of the placement. Some people find the'should I have seen that' glimpse of an exposed lower back tattoos highly enticing. This is a major advantage if you want to project an attractive, brave image.

Placing a tattoo on your back also implies that you're going to not be prepared to see it under standard conditions. In reality, you can only see it if you are really flexible or when you catch a glance of it in a mirror. So if you want a tattoo, without to see it all the time, a back placement may be the solution. The downsides Of lower back tattoos is that they carry one significant flaw - they are intensely unoriginal. The trend has lasted for so long that millions of ladies all around the globe have tattoos placed on their lower back region. In truth, it's become virtually impossible to get a new way to set a tattoo design on your lumbar region. But beyond that, certain unflattering jargon terms have developed to elucidate lower back tattoos and the girls who have them, including'tramp stamp', and'gramp stamp', which refers back to the postulate that in 40 to fifty years, the world will be full of aged girls with lower back tattoos.

So if you're making an attempt to find something rather more original, it's best to avoid lower back tattoos. Another major drawback of lower back tattoos placed on the lumbar region is the indisputable fact that you're going to not be ready to see your tattoo unless you look in a mirror. This should be an advantage if you want a tattoo but do not wish to have a look at it all the time. But if you want to see your new design on a consistent basis, dodge getting a tattoo anywhere in your back. An Original Alternative to consider If you like the idea of lower back tattoos, but would like to retain an element of originality, try placing your tattoo design further round your torso, so that it sits on the sound of the body above one or both of your hips. At the moment tattoos placed in this location are relatively rare, so if you're trying to find something original, it may be worth considering.
